应对边缘AI大爆发,传统嵌入式厂商新征程
近日,在Computex 2023上,来自TI、NXP和ST的处理器领域相关负责人,介绍了各自公司对于嵌入式系统的未来,尤其是边缘AI领域的理解,以及各自公司的应对方案。
德州仪器:边缘AI视觉处理赋能嵌入式系统未来可能
德州仪器处理器部门副总裁Sameer Wasson做了《边缘AI视觉处理赋能嵌入式系统未来可能》演讲报告,他表示,全方位的嵌入式处理产品组合应该具有三大要素:更高整合的感知能力;在嵌入式系统中普及更多AI以及更易使用。
Wasson表示,嵌入式系统的开发需要平衡成本与开发难度,以及结合软硬件协同优化,从而实现最佳效果的设计。另外,嵌入式系统开发人员更希望可移植可复用的软硬件设计,因此平台化策略至关重要。
TI在边缘AI领域具有三大优势,包括高集成可扩展的边缘AI处理器组合,为现有应用轻松导入人工智能和机器学习功能以及开源工具和软件堆栈协助AI开发,甚至不需要工程师自己开发任何编码便可为系统添加AI功能。
今年TI一口气推出了六款基于 Arm Cortex的嵌入式视觉处理器,包括 AM62A、AM68A 和 AM69A 处理器,算力从1TOPS到32TOPS,支持从一个到最多12个摄像头。
自从TI推出AM335x,将64位处理概念广泛引入工业应用之后,Arm开始进入更广泛的工业领域。
而在AM6x中,从售价到功耗,从开发门槛到可扩展性,TI都力求做到业界领先。
NXP:边缘AI需要更多的安全性
恩智浦AI和ML战略及技术全球总监Ali Osman Ors则强调了边缘AI在安全性方面的注意事项。
根据 IBM 的一份报告,制造业是 2021 年全球受攻击最严重的行业,勒索软件仍然是罪魁祸首,占攻击的 23%。而未来,随着智能工厂的不断演进,安全问题将会更加涌现。
Ali强调,机器学习需要全方位的进行防御,这其中既包括代码和设备,更包括很多关键数据。他例举了几种防护方法,包括防御对抗性攻击、防范数据中毒、防范模型窃取、性能监护以及模型保护。
IP是机器学习的重要组成部分,在机器学习模型的知识产权上,如果分类是基于诸如“猫/狗”、“汽车/行人/交通灯”等事实要素,难以判断是否可以对训练数据集主张版权,因为这不包含任何创意。然而,在工业或医疗行业,比如开发出一套独特的图像诊断模型,为了防止遭到窃取,需要一些独特的加密方式。
恩智浦将eIQ Model Watermark工具引入至eIQ工具包中进行机器学习开发,把水印加入机器学习的方法。开发人员可选取特定类型的带秘密图形的图像进行组合,生成触发图像,Watermark工具可基于触发图像扩展原始训练数据。用户选择将触发图像标记为“水印类别”,与底层图像的实际类别区分开,比如,将实际是猫的触发图像标记为“狗”。使用这个扩展训练集进行训练会生成一个模型,在触发图像上具有独特的功能,称为“Mountweazels”。这就是机器学习模型的水印。当独立训练的模型采用触发图像时,得到的分类是触发图像底层图的实际类别,但是原始训练的机器学习模型以及抄袭了带水印机器模型的系统都会划分为“水印类别”。这表明该模型抄袭了原始模型。
并且恩智浦eIQ模型水印工具经过优化,不会影响模型的性能或精度。
关于产品方面,恩智浦今年以来陆续推出了i.MX9系列的多款新品,采用了Cortex A55内核,并且包括独立的类MCU实时域、Energy Flex架构、先进的由EdgeLock安全区域加持的安全性和专用多传感数据处理引擎(图形、图像、显示、音频和语音)。
EdgeLock是一款经过预配置的安全子系统,简化了复杂安全加密技术的实现,并帮助设计人员避免代价高昂的错误。
而面对未来,Ali认为生成式AI和量子计算会对密码学带来前所未有的冲击。为此恩智浦正在进行持续创新,比如美国国家标准与技术研究所(NIST)在2022年选择恩智浦联合署名的Crystals-Kyber专业算法用于后量子密码学标准的制定。
意法半导体:边缘AI可带来更高能效
意法半导体亚太区微控制器和数字IC产品部、(MDG)物联网/人工智能技术创新中心及数字营销副总裁朱利安(Arnaud Julienne)强调了边缘AI在节能减耗上的作用。
朱利安表示,住宅和商业建筑电力消耗可以占大城市的90%,其中主要用电包括照明、HVAC、家电等应用。意法半导体正在各项领域中透过数字技术的革命改善电力浪费。比如,帮助洗衣机从D级能效提升至A级,采用BLDC取代AC电机,为HVAC提升30%效率,降低电视机的待机功耗以及支持LED照明等等。
朱利安例举了洗衣机上称重应用,利用搭载edge AI算法的STM32G4 MCU以及SLLIMM IPM芯片,测量滚动旋转过程中的电流,即可在无传感器情况下进行衣物的准确称重,相比传统称重方式,准确率提升了三倍,这可以使电机运行更准确从而节省更多电力及水资源。这种被意法半导体称为Zero Speed Full Torque的算法,还可以确保在电机启动时的电流更小,从而进一步节省电力。
另外一个例子则是利用边缘AI进行光伏发电过程中的拉弧检测,利用STM32的AI功能,可以比传统拉弧检测提升99%的检测准确度。
2019年意法半导体发布STM32 cube AI,目前已经成为嵌入式领域最流行的AI开发工具。2021年,意法半导体发布NanoEdge AI,内置大量的包括上述拉弧检测、重量检测等AI库函数,可以让没有任何AI技能甚至数据的工程师开发AI产品。2023年,意法半导体又发布了Cube AI云服务,进一步简化开发流程。
今年意法半导体发布了首款带有NPU的MCU STM32N6,其神经网络加速(ST YoloLC NN)能力相比STM32H7提升了75倍,并且具有MIPI、ISP以及H.264等图像功能,以及STSafe安全要素。
而在MPU方面,意法半导体发布了第二代工业4.0级边缘AI微处理器STM32MP25,采用Arm Cortex-A35内核并支持TSN。
朱利安还强调了意法半导体在无线连接方面的组合,除了蓝牙、Sub-1GHz以及UWB之外,意法半导体还开发了ST60,是基于60GHz毫米波技术的高带宽、低功耗创新性无线连接技术。
最后,朱利安表示随着MCU的需求越来越旺盛,意法半导体正在广泛投资内部产能以及积极拓展合作伙伴,确保未来MCU的产能供应。
以上是应对边缘AI大爆发,传统嵌入式厂商新征程的详细内容。更多信息请关注PHP中文网其他相关文章!

热AI工具

Undresser.AI Undress
人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over
用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ool
免费脱衣服图片

Clothoff.io
AI脱衣机

AI Hentai Generator
免费生成ai无尽的。

热门文章

热工具

记事本++7.3.1
好用且免费的代码编辑器

SublimeText3汉化版
中文版,非常好用

禅工作室 13.0.1
功能强大的PHP集成开发环境

Dreamweaver CS6
视觉化网页开发工具

SublimeText3 Mac版
神级代码编辑软件(SublimeText3)

热门话题

大家好,我卡颂。许多程序员朋友都希望参与自己的AI产品开发。我们可以根据"流程自动化程度"和"AI应用程度"将产品的形态划分为四个象限。其中:流程自动化程度衡量「产品的服务流程有多少需要人工介入」AI应用程度衡量「AI在产品中应用的比重」首先,限制AI的能力,以处理一张AI图片应用,用户在应用内通过与UI交互就能完成完整的服务流程,从而自动化程度高。同时,“AI图片处理”重度依赖AI的能力,所以AI应用程度高。第二象限,是常规的应用开发领域,比如开发个知识管理应用、时间管理应用、流程自动化程度高

利用C++实现嵌入式系统的实时音视频处理功能嵌入式系统的应用范围越来越广泛,尤其在音视频处理领域的需求日益增长。面对这样的需求,利用C++语言实现嵌入式系统的实时音视频处理功能成为一种常见的选择。本文将介绍如何使用C++语言开发嵌入式系统的实时音视频处理功能,并给出相应的代码示例。为了实现实时音视频处理功能,首先需要理解音视频处理的基本流程。一般来说,音视频

嵌入式系统开发一直是信息技术领域中一项具有挑战性的任务,它需要开发者有深厚的技术底蕴和丰富的经验。而随着嵌入式设备变得越来越复杂和功能需求变得越来越多样化,选择适合开发的编程语言也变得至关重要。在这篇文章中,我们将深入探讨Go语言在嵌入式系统开发中的优势和挑战,并提供具体的代码示例来帮助读者更好地理解。Go语言作为一种现代化的编程语言,以其简洁、高效、可靠和

Go语言因其并发性、高性能和丰富的生态系统,非常适合开发区块链边缘计算应用程序。用例包括智能合约执行、数据收集和分析以及身份验证。Go代码示例展示了在边缘设备上执行智能合约和收集和分析数据。

嵌入式系统是指在特定的硬件平台上运行的应用程序,通常用于控制、监控和处理各种设备和系统。C++作为一种功能强大的编程语言,在嵌入式系统开发中广泛应用。本文将介绍C++嵌入式系统开发的基本概念和技术,以及如何打造高可靠性的嵌入式应用。一、嵌入式系统开发概述嵌入式系统开发需要对硬件平台有一定的了解,因为嵌入式应用程序需要直接与硬件交互。除了硬件平台之外,嵌入式系

在2023年,生成式人工智能(ArtificialIntelligenceGeneratedContent,简称AIGC)成为科技领域最热门的话题,毫无疑问那么对于制造行业来说,他们应该怎样从生成式AI这项新兴技术中获益?广大正在实施数字化转型的中小企业,又可以由此获得怎样的启示?最近,亚马逊云科技与制造行业的代表一同合作,就中国制造业目前的发展趋势、传统制造业数字化转型所面临的挑战与机遇,以及生成式人工智能对制造业的创新重塑等话题进行了分享和深入探讨生成式AI在制造行业的应用现状提及中国制造业

随着物联网和云计算的快速发展,边缘计算逐渐成为新的热点领域。边缘计算是指将数据处理和计算能力从传统的云计算中心转移到物理设备的边缘节点上,以提高数据处理的效率和减少延迟。而MongoDB作为一种强大的NoSQL数据库,其在边缘计算领域的应用也越来越受到关注。一、MongoDB与边缘计算的结合实践在边缘计算中,设备通常具有有限的计算和存储资源。而MongoDB

如何使用C++实现嵌入式系统的定时任务功能嵌入式系统中经常需要实现定时任务功能,即在特定的时间间隔内执行一些任务。C++作为一种强大的编程语言,为我们提供了许多工具和库来实现这样的功能。本文将介绍如何使用C++编程语言实现嵌入式系统中的定时任务功能,并提供一些代码示例。使用计时器中断在嵌入式系统中,我们可以使用计时器中断来实现定时任务功能。通过设置计时器的计
